How they compare
India currently reports 29.5% against 27.0% in Myanmar, a difference of 2.5%.
That makes India's figure about 1.1 times Myanmar's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 33 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Myanmar ahead.
India ranks 173rd and Myanmar ranks 176th of 196 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, India averaged higher in 1 and Myanmar in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| India | Myanmar |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 8.2% | 13.1% | 4.9% | Myanmar |
| 2000s | 14.1% | 17.9% | 3.8% | Myanmar |
| 2010s | 22.2% | 22.8% | 0.6% | Myanmar |
| 2020s | 28.5% | 26.4% | 2.0% | India |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Prevalence of overweight adults is the percentage of adults ages 18 and over whose Body Mass Index (BMI) is more than 25 kg/m2. Body Mass Index (BMI) is a simple index of weight-for-height, or the weight in kilograms divided by the square of the height in meters.
